Incident Response Management Project Manager

HireRight is the premier global background screening and workforce solutions provider. The Incident Response Management Project Manager plays a critical role in mitigating risks by managing various risk mitigating projects from Discovery to Closure, ensuring timely resolution and effective communication among stakeholders.

Responsibilities

Manage IRM (Incident Response Management) issues received via email or Jira from Discovery to Closure
Apply proven project management methodologies (both traditional/waterfall and agile/scrum) to coordinate all planning, development, testing, documentation, and implementation activities
Develop project management deliverables, including project forms, scope, requirements, plans, issue tracking and status reports
Investigate and collect details of the incident in its entirety, validate data received, assess and determine the impact, and engage the appropriate stakeholders
Work with cross-functional teams to fix and remediate the issues in a timely manner. Ensure steps have been taken to suspend production of impacted workflows for ongoing issues
Schedule, lead and facilitate IRM meetings/calls. Document the findings, action items, and next steps
Submit detailed EDM tickets for impact lists. Validate report received and work with EDM to ensure the correct and complete data is pulled
Enforce project deadlines and schedules. Follow up on tickets submitted (Fix, RCA, EDM) to ensure prioritization and progress and escalate as needed
Prepare and upload batches for re-run audits. Work with Operations Mgmt. on upload schedule. Work with PSO on creating custom accounts and/or packages if needed. Monitor batch progress and completion
Engage Operations for post audit review assistance. Spot check results received before finalizing impact then seed the list
Track progress of the projects and deliverables and regularly report status to stakeholders and internal clients
Create client talk track and upon request, client facing RCA, and obtain approval from Compliance before distributing
Update and provide support to Account Management and CET on incidents and next steps. Assist with submitting new orders and client credits as needed
Conduct postmortem “lessons learned” review sessions. Identify gaps in our processes and recommend solutions to optimize the quality of our services and products
